The general recommendation, and again this is only a rough guide, is that a line laser, rotary laser or pipe laser should be calibrated a minimum of every 12 months to maintain its accuracy. However, if it is used frequently or daily such as a concreter with a rotary laser or a drainer with a pipe laser the laser level should be seen by a.. 2.
